6-bed family compound | commanding township views | pool & event potential | heritage & bushfire overlays
This property presents a rare, large-scale family living opportunity within walking distance of Angaston’s main street. Its commanding position, substantial 566mΒ² building footprint, and 2495mΒ² terraced gardens are atypical for the township, offering generational living or a lifestyle-entertainment hub with inherent income potential through events or accommodation. The configuration-six bedrooms, multiple living areas, a cellar, and an oversized triple garage-caters specifically to large or multigenerational families seeking privacy and space for substantial gatherings, a profile underserved by typical suburban stock. The established, low-maintenance grounds and premium finishes like ducted vacuuming and underfloor heating solidify its position as a premium, turn-key holding.
The primary decision points are the cost and constraints imposed by the detected heritage and bushfire overlays, which may impact renovation plans and insurance premiums. The asking price sits at the top of its estimated range, demanding a premium for its unique attributes over nearby sales. The commercial logic for unlocking value lies in formally pursuing its noted potential for weddings or a B&B, leveraging its views and scale. For a buyer, this is a long-term lifestyle holding rather than a short-term investment; its value is best preserved by utilizing its full capacity for large-scale living or a carefully permitted commercial venture, accepting the operational realities of a large estate.
A nearby comparable sale at 21 Aug 2024 was a 3-bed, 1-bath house on 2032mΒ² which sold for $680,000 after 59 days. This property, with double the bedrooms and bathrooms and a building footprint nearly five times larger on a bigger block, justifies a significant price multiplier. The differential underscores the premium for a complete, high-capacity family compound over a standard acreage, anchoring this property’s value in its superior scale and functionality.

Market Insight:
Angaston presents as an affordable and tightly held Barossa Valley market, with demand driven by a mix of families and investors attracted by solid rental yields. Recent price growth has been robust, supported by low sales volumes indicating constrained supply. Future performance will hinge on maintaining this supply-demand balance, though its relative affordability within the region mitigates significant downside risk.
